Professional Dental Cleanings
Even individuals who brush and floss carefully every day can still benefit from professional cleanings at a canby dental office. Dental hygienists use specialized tools to remove plaque and hardened tartar that cannot be eliminated through regular brushing alone.
Plaque is a sticky film of bacteria that constantly forms on teeth. If plaque is not removed properly, it hardens into tartar, which can lead to gum inflammation and tooth decay. A professional cleaning at a canby dental office removes these deposits, helping to protect both teeth and gums.
These appointments also provide an opportunity for dental professionals to guide patients on improving their daily oral hygiene routines.
Fluoride Treatments for Stronger Teeth
Fluoride treatments are another preventive service commonly provided by a canby dental office. Fluoride is a mineral that strengthens tooth enamel and helps prevent cavities. It works by remineralizing weakened areas of enamel and making teeth more resistant to acid attacks from bacteria.
Many children receive fluoride treatments during routine dental visits, but adults can also benefit from this preventive measure. A canby dental office may recommend fluoride therapy for patients who have a higher risk of tooth decay or enamel sensitivity.
How Fluoride Protects Teeth
Fluoride treatments at a canby dental office help:
- Strengthen enamel and prevent cavities
- Reverse early signs of tooth decay
- Protect sensitive teeth
- Improve overall resistance to bacterial damage
This simple preventive treatment can significantly reduce the likelihood of dental problems over time.
Dental Sealants for Cavity Prevention
Dental sealants are thin protective coatings applied to the chewing surfaces of molars. Many dentists at a canby dental office recommend sealants for children and teenagers because these teeth often have deep grooves where bacteria can accumulate.
Once applied, sealants act as a barrier that prevents food particles and plaque from entering these grooves. This significantly reduces the risk of cavities in hard-to-clean areas.
Although commonly used for children, adults can also receive sealants at a canby dental office if their molars are prone to decay.

Digital X-Rays for Precise Diagnosis
Digital X-rays are one of the most important technologies used in a modern canby dental office. Unlike traditional film X-rays, digital imaging provides faster results and exposes patients to significantly less radiation. Dentists can immediately view high-resolution images on a computer screen, allowing them to identify hidden dental problems such as cavities between teeth, bone loss, or impacted teeth.
A professional canby dental office uses digital radiography not only to diagnose problems but also to monitor treatment progress. For example, dentists may use digital X-rays to track healing after procedures like root canals, implants, or periodontal treatments.
Benefits of Digital X-Rays
- Reduced radiation exposure compared to traditional X-rays
- Instant image availability for faster diagnosis
- Clear, high-resolution images for better accuracy
- Easy storage and sharing of patient records
Because of these advantages, digital imaging has become a standard feature in a modern canby dental office.

3D Imaging and Cone Beam CT Scans
For more complex dental procedures, some clinics use 3D imaging systems such as Cone Beam Computed Tomography (CBCT). This advanced technology allows dentists in a canby dental office to view detailed three-dimensional images of teeth, bone structures, nerves, and surrounding tissues.
CBCT imaging is especially useful for procedures such as dental implants, orthodontics, and oral surgery. By using 3D scans, a canby dental office can plan treatments with remarkable precision and minimize risks.
These detailed scans help dentists determine the exact position for implants, evaluate bone density, and avoid sensitive nerve areas.
Computer-Aided Design and Manufacturing (CAD/CAM)
Another advanced technology sometimes available in a canby dental office is CAD/CAM dentistry. This technology allows dentists to design and create dental restorations such as crowns, veneers, and inlays using digital impressions and computer software.
With CAD/CAM systems, a canby dental office can sometimes complete restorations in a single visit. Instead of waiting weeks for a dental laboratory, patients may receive their crowns or veneers on the same day.
Advantages of CAD/CAM Dentistry
- Same-day crowns and restorations
- Digital impressions instead of traditional molds
- High precision and natural-looking restorations
- Reduced number of dental visits
This technology greatly improves convenience and comfort for patients visiting a canby dental office.

Dental Fillings for Treating Cavities
One of the most frequent treatments performed in a canby dental office is cavity treatment using dental fillings. Tooth decay occurs when bacteria produce acids that weaken tooth enamel. If left untreated, cavities can grow larger and eventually damage the inner structure of the tooth.
During a filling procedure at a canby dental office, the dentist removes the decayed portion of the tooth and fills the space with a restorative material. Modern fillings are often made from composite resin, which matches the natural color of the tooth and provides strong protection.
Average Cost of Dental Fillings
- Composite tooth-colored filling: $150 – $350 per tooth
- Amalgam filling: $100 – $250 per tooth
A professional canby dental office will explain the best material option based on durability, aesthetics, and the location of the cavity.
Dental Crowns for Damaged Teeth
Dental crowns are another common treatment available at a canby dental office. Crowns are custom-made caps that cover a damaged or weakened tooth, restoring its strength and appearance. Dentists often recommend crowns when a tooth has severe decay, fractures, or structural weakness.
A canby dental office typically uses materials such as porcelain, ceramic, metal alloys, or zirconia for crown restorations. Porcelain crowns are especially popular because they closely resemble natural teeth.
Typical Crown Procedure
The crown treatment process at a canby dental office usually includes:
- Removing damaged tooth structure
- Taking digital impressions of the tooth
- Placing a temporary crown
- Installing a custom permanent crown
The average cost of a dental crown at a canby dental office generally ranges between $900 and $1,500 depending on materials and complexity.
Root Canal Treatment for Tooth Infections
Root canal therapy is another important treatment provided by a canby dental office. This procedure is necessary when infection reaches the pulp inside a tooth. Without treatment, the infection may cause severe pain and eventually lead to tooth loss.
During root canal treatment, the dentist at the canby dental office removes the infected pulp, cleans the inner canals of the tooth, and seals the space to prevent further infection. A dental crown is often placed afterward to strengthen the tooth.
Signs You May Need a Root Canal
- Severe or persistent tooth pain
- Sensitivity to hot or cold temperatures
- Swelling around the gums
- Darkening of the tooth
The typical cost of root canal treatment at a canby dental office ranges from $700 to $1,500 depending on the tooth involved.
Dental Implants for Missing Teeth
Dental implants are a long-term solution for replacing missing teeth and are frequently offered at a modern canby dental office. An implant consists of a titanium post surgically placed into the jawbone, which acts as an artificial tooth root. A crown is then attached to the implant to create a natural-looking replacement tooth.
A canby dental office may recommend implants because they provide excellent stability, preserve jawbone health, and restore normal chewing function.
Benefits of Dental Implants
- Natural appearance and function
- Long-lasting durability
- Prevention of jawbone deterioration
- Improved comfort compared to removable dentures
The cost of a dental implant procedure at a canby dental office may range from $3,000 to $5,000 per tooth depending on complexity and additional treatments required.

How Dental Insurance Works
Dental insurance can significantly reduce out-of-pocket expenses for many treatments at a canby dental office. Most dental insurance plans cover preventive services such as exams and cleanings at little or no cost to the patient. These plans often encourage regular visits because preventive care reduces the likelihood of expensive treatments later.
A typical dental insurance plan may follow this structure:
Common Insurance Coverage Structure
- Preventive care: 80–100% coverage
- Basic treatments (fillings, simple extractions): 50–80% coverage
- Major procedures (crowns, bridges, implants): 25–50% coverage
Dental teams at a canby dental office often help patients verify insurance benefits and explain which treatments are covered. They may also submit insurance claims on behalf of the patient, simplifying the process and reducing administrative stress.

Brushing Techniques Recommended by Dentists
Many people brush their teeth regularly but may not use the correct technique. Dental professionals at a canby dental office often demonstrate proper brushing methods to ensure patients remove plaque effectively without damaging gums.
The recommended brushing technique involves holding the toothbrush at a 45-degree angle toward the gumline and using gentle circular motions. Brushing too aggressively can damage enamel and irritate gum tissue, so dentists at a canby dental office encourage gentle but thorough cleaning.
Common Brushing Mistakes to Avoid
- Brushing too hard and damaging gums
- Skipping the gumline where plaque accumulates
- Using an old toothbrush with worn bristles
- Brushing for less than two minutes
A proper brushing technique combined with regular visits to a canby dental office provides strong protection against dental disease.
